Did Niki Lauda try to stop race?

Yes. As the safety spokesperson for the drivers, the real Niki Lauda called a meeting of his fellow racers in an attempt to have the race at Nürburgring stopped, but many of his fellow drivers didn’t agree. In the end, he lost by one vote and was left with little choice but to race.

Did Niki Lauda get burned? In the race’s second lap, Lauda lost control of his car and slammed into an embankment. The car burst into flames, and Lauda was pulled from the wreckage, having inhaled noxious gasses. He sustained burns that cost him his eyelids, half of an ear, and large portions of his scalp.

Did Niki Lauda buy his way into F1?

In 1971 he secured a loan against his life insurance policy to buy his way into the March Engineering Formula Two team. While still primarily a Formula Two driver, Lauda participated in his first F1 race during his initial season with March, and in 1972 he raced in 12 F1 events.

Did Niki Lauda get out of the car in Japan?

Niki Lauda quit the 1976 Japanese Grand Prix not only because of the rain. It wasn’t just because he felt that the rain-soaked track was unsafe. To complicate things, Lauda’s tear ducts had been damaged by fire during the horrific crash at the German Grand Prix earlier in the season.

Who won 1976 F1 championship?

James Hunt, in full James Simon Wallis Hunt, (born August 29, 1947, London, England—died June 15, 1993, London), British race-car driver who won the 1976 Formula One (F1) Grand Prix world championship by one point over his Austrian archrival, Niki Lauda. Hunt began racing his own car in Formula Ford events in 1969.

Who is Guy Edwards?

Guy Richard Goronwy Edwards, QGM (born 30 December 1942) is a former racing driver from England. Best known for his sportscar and British Formula One career, as well as for brokering sponsorship deals, Edwards participated in 17 World Championship Formula One Grands Prix, debuting on 13 January 1974.

Did James Hunt and Niki become friends?

While they competed on the track, Hunt readily admitted that the two were good friends from their early days « gypsi(ng) around Europe together » in Formula Three, where they became « mates, not just casual acquaintances. » The enduring friendship between the two continued until Hunt’s death in 1993.

Is Michael Schumacher brain damaged?

While skiing off-piste, Michael fell and hit his head on a rock, suffering a horrific injury despite wearing a helmet. He was air-lifted to a hospital in Grenoble, and after undergoing two surgeries was placed in a medically induced coma for six months to help reduce the swelling of his brain.
